"Pleurotus sp. is interesting as medicinal mushroom due to the significant content of beta-glucans. These polysaccharides are supposed to be responsible for some healthy properties of various mushrooms. There is evidence to study how beta-glucan distribution in fruit body depends on genetic differences between strains of Pleurotus sp., cultivation conditions and harvest term. The aim of this study was characterisation of beta-glucans and chitin-glucan complexes of four strains of Pleurotus sp. The contents of beta-glucans were determined separately in pilei and stems by Megazyme (Ireland) enzymatic kit contained exo-1,3--glucanase and -glucosidase. Soluble and insoluble glucans were isolated according to the modified procedure of Chenghua et al. (2000). Lyophilised samples obtained from dialysed extracts, as well as insoluble residues, were analyzed by spectroscopic and separation methods.
